TRANSFORMATION OFFICER

37 HOURS PER WEEK

GRADE 9 39862 - 42839

Are you passionate about driving change and improving services in the public sector? Do you thrive in a fast-paced environment where adaptability, innovation, and collaboration are key?

As a Transformation Officer you'll play a vital role in delivering Wyre Council's ambitious Transformation Programme and support with preparatory work for potential Local Government Reorganisation. You'll provide expert project management advice and support helping us achieve the goals set out in our Council Plan.

This is a fantastic opportunity to join a forward-thinking council that embraces change. You will be working as part of a small high‑profile team on key projects that shape the future of local government.

The role involves:
  • Leading and supporting service and transformation reviews.
  • Coordinating our Project Management Framework and delivering training.
  • Mapping and analysing processes, challenging current practices and recommending improvements.
  • Preparing reports for senior leadership and the Transformation Board.
  • Fostering innovation by sharing best practice and encouraging creative thinking.
  • Building strong relationships across the council to enable collaborative problem‑solving.

As an employer we offer a range of employee benefits including a minimum of 24 days annual leave plus bank holidays rising to 29 days subject to length of service (pro‑rata), great work‑life balance with flexible working arrangements, excellent employer pension contribution, free on‑site parking, discounted gym membership, access to occupational health and development opportunities, and a supportive workplace culture that allows you to develop and grow.
